Python’da bir string içinde belirli bir karakterin sadece ilk kaç kez geçtiğini nasıl bulabilirim?
Python\'da String İçinde Belirli Bir Karakterin İlk Kaç Kez Geçtiğini Bulma
Python\'da bir string içinde belirli bir karakterin yalnızca ilk birkaç kez geçtiğini bulmak için aşağıdaki adımları izleyebilirsiniz:- String\'i Tanımlayın: İşlem yapacağınız metni tanımlayın.
- Karakteri Belirleyin: Bulmak istediğiniz karakteri belirleyin.
- İlk N Kez Bulma: Bir döngü kullanarak karakteri arayın ve sayısını kontrol edin.
Örnek Kod
Aşağıdaki örnek kod, \'a\' karakterinin bir string içinde ilk 3 kez geçtiği durumları gösterir: ```python def ilk_n_kez_gecis(metin, karakter, n): sayac = 0 for i, harf in enumerate(metin): if harf == karakter: sayac += 1 if sayac == n: return metin[:i + 1] return metin metin = \"Python programlama dili\" sonuc = ilk_n_kez_gecis(metin, \'a\', 3) print(sonuc) ``` Bu kod, \'a\' karakterinin string içinde ilk 3 kez geçtiği yere kadar olan kısmı döndürecektir.
Aynı kategoriden
- Matematikte çarpanlara ayırma
- Python’da bir liste içerisindeki en büyük elemanı bulmanın en etkili yolu nedir?
- Python’da bir metin içinde belirli bir kelimenin kaç farklı şekilde geçtiğini nasıl bulabilirim?
- Mühendislik alanında en yaygın kullanılan programlama dilleri hangileridir?
- HTML nedir ve temel kullanım alanları nelerdir?
- En iyi işletim sistemi hangisi?
- Toplama işlemi için hangi matematiksel sembolü kullanırız?
- Mantıksal operatörlerin kullanımı nasıl yapılır?